Output a104390fa44618bcfc43bf53931368f19bea5fb6e33b9a2d3653235aa793a508:0

value
615672
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4636e6c146a8b1c2caf1c9a22bfe87da72273a84 OP_EQUALVERIFY OP_CHECKSIG
address
17QG53WpvV7o1oocpnFAnbZRNpZEMcyybf
transaction
a104390fa44618bcfc43bf53931368f19bea5fb6e33b9a2d3653235aa793a508
confirmations
455900
spent
true